If university is your goal and you do not yet meet the entry requirement for the Access to HE Diploma then this Pre-Access course is for you. This course is focused on developing your skills to enable you to access University or vocational based study. The course is specifically designed for students who do not yet have a full level 2 qualification or GCSE English grade A - C and who wish to progress to University through an Access to HE Diploma route. The course will develop and strengthen your English and math's skills to a high level 2 standard and you will work towards undertaking your GCSEs at the end of the programme. The course will introduce you to academic reading and subjects which will be delivered on the level 3 course. This course will provide an excellent grounding in academic writing as well as further enhancing your study skills. You will study over two terms to allow you to adapt, reflect and plan your individual learning journey. By the end of this course you will have experienced what it is like to be a long term residential student, undertaken a range of enrichment activities and widened your skills and knowledge of a variety of different subjects.

Course information

Name: Pre Access (Group A - Mon-Wed) Qualification title: Certificate in Preparing for Further Study in Health, Social Care and Social Work (QCF) Qualification type: Other regulated/accredited qualification Assessment Written assignments, portfolio, presentations, role-plays, reports, timed assessments, exams, action plans and research. Awarding Open College Network Eastern Region (trading as Gateway Qualifications) Created 20160111 09:08:34 Updated 20160111 09:08:34
